Trading in Markets? Is Your Broker Legit? Learn to Tell the Difference
Diving into the world of finance can be both exciting and daunting. You're entrusting your hard-earned money to someone else, hoping they'll help you grow your wealth. But how do you ensure that the broker you choose is on the up-and-up? A legitimate broker is essential for a profitable investment journey. Here are some tips to help you separate the good from the bad:
- Scrutinize their history: Look for brokers that are registered with the appropriate governing bodies. Check online reviews from other investors.
- Review their expenses: Be aware of unexpected fees that can eat into your returns. Compare rates across different brokers.
- Interact with their customer service team: A available support team is crucial when you have concerns. Test their promptness.
